Popular Post PSUFrankenstein Posted Thursday at 03:06 AM Author Popular Post Report Posted Thursday at 03:06 AM Pretty good day at Silver mountain. They have some pretty steep runs although some of the stuff off lift 4, as well as the North Face, was closed for avalanche risk. The glades that were open were pretty fun and good spacing in the trees. It was a little confusing to get around and I had to avoid the cat tracks since the snow was pretty slow. It was probably 75 degrees at one point, I was drinking beers in a t shirt. Got back to the base area around 3 and did some fishing. The river is running pretty high from the snow melting. I went fishing after dinner too and missed a few fish on dry flies, but there wasn't much action. 10 1 Quote

PSUFrankenstein Posted Saturday at 12:53 AM Author Report Posted Saturday at 12:53 AM Lost trail was awesome. The chair 4 stuff reminds me a bit of the stuff off Millie at Brighton. Chutes, cliffs, trees, bowls, and some nice groomers. Started off by hitting some stuff off the chair near the lodge...then over to chair 4. Did a trail and then a chute called wall of fame and also a few tree runs. It was a little sketchy and icy at the top but the rest was nice. Also hit some groomers which were firm to start but softened up by mid morning. Went out sacajawea trees, which turned out to be a bad idea as I ended up hiking back pretty far once it flattened out. Trees got pretty tight but at the top they were pretty manageable. 4 1 Quote
